As the senior shareholder and president of Baum Hedlund Aristei & Goldman, Attorney Michael L. Baum has led the firm through thousands of major wrongful death and personal injury cases against many of the largest companies in the world. When people suffer harm due to defective pharmaceutical drugs, dangerous consumer products, or commercial transportation disasters, they often turn to Attorney Baum and his acclaimed legal team to pursue justice. 

Attorney Baum began his practice more than 35 years ago, focusing primarily on airline accidents and pharmaceutical product liability claims. Since the firm’s early days, the scale of Michael’s practice has only increased. Michael manages the firm and oversees the mass tort department and consumer class action lawsuits. Although his work is complex and requires him to deal with devastating subject matter on a day-to-day basis, he is motivated by the opportunity to vindicate people’s rights when they are victimized by corporate wrongdoing.

In 1999, Attorney Baum served on the trial team in the only hemophiliac AIDS case to be tried before a jury. Michael and his team represented Leo and Shirley Dixon, whose son contracted the HIV virus and was diagnosed with AIDS after receiving a hemophilia medication contaminated with the virus, the suit alleged. 

In court, the trial team proved that the medication was, in fact, contaminated. Two of the medication’s manufacturers, Cutter Biological and Alpha Therapeutics, negligently used plasma from high-risk donors with the HIV virus. The jury awarded $35.3 million in damages. While the judge later overturned the verdict due to a technical error, the case provided justice and solace for the bereaved Dixon family and for the nation’s other hemophiliacs similarly affected by the same medication.

Attorney Baum served on the trial teams for the first three Monsanto (now Bayer) Roundup cancer cases, which alleged the herbicide Roundup caused plaintiffs to develop non-Hodgkin’s lymphoma. The Monsanto trials include: 

• Pilliod et al. v. Monsanto Co.

• Johnson v. Monsanto Co.

• Hardeman v. Monsanto Co.

The Monsanto trials culminated in jury verdicts worth nearly $2.5 billion in total. The National Trial Lawyers recognized the trial team for Pilliod with the Mass Tort Trial Team of the Year for 2019. The jury verdict in Pilliod was the largest in the state of California for 2019, the second-largest in the country for 2019, and the ninth-largest in U.S. history for a personal injury case.
